Output 21c458e97e207ea5f1c7d14b103c7df714c6ae525f99d81ced20cf08e89ad5e2:1

value
394931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f66f119f59cf26f74b7264729dc7b74f752461a OP_EQUAL
address
3Lbf7msaC5gEd9P568ugnCaLeMJYEiQyKp
transaction
21c458e97e207ea5f1c7d14b103c7df714c6ae525f99d81ced20cf08e89ad5e2